Couple Charged After Drawing Swastikas And Throwing Feces At GOP Office And Charlie Kirk Poster


Police in Arlington Heights, Illinois, have identified and charged two individuals in connection with the vandalism of a local political office earlier this week. Brock McNerney, 72, and Moisette McNerney, 69, face misdemeanor charges of criminal damage to property and defacement of property following an incident on March 23, 2026.
Surveillance footage released by authorities reportedly captures the couple targeting the Republicans of Wheeling Township headquarters. The footage shows the suspects allegedly applying Nazi symbols, profanity, and biological waste to the exterior of the building.
An image of political commentator Charlie Kirk displayed at the office was among the items specifically defaced during the Monday evening incident. This marks the second time the Wheeling Township office has been targeted by vandals since December 2025.
According to the Arlington Heights Police Department, the McNerneys were taken into custody following an investigation into the video evidence. Both individuals were processed and released on their own recognizance pending a future court appearance in Cook County.
Leaders of the Republicans of Wheeling Township expressed disappointment in the escalation of political tensions. GOP officials emphasized that political differences should be settled through civil discourse rather than criminal activity or destruction of property.
The incident occurs amidst a heightened political climate as President Donald Trump continues his current term in the White House. Local residents have expressed concern over the nature of the vandalism, particularly the use of hate symbols in a public space.
While charges have been filed, police continue to review surveillance from the surrounding area to ensure no other parties were involved in the disturbance. The township office serves as a primary hub for local political activity and is currently undergoing repairs to remove the damage.
The Arlington Heights Police Department has not yet commented on a potential motive beyond the evidence captured in the footage. Legal proceedings for the McNerneys are expected to begin within the next month as the investigation concludes.
